Ingredients
Units
Scale
For the Base:
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
- 1/2 cup sugar
- 2 large eggs
- 1/2 tsp vanilla extract
- 1/2 tsp baking powder
- 1/4 cup milk
For the Mousse Layer:
- 1 cup heavy whipping cream
- 1/2 cup cream cheese (softened)
- 1/4 cup powdered sugar
- 1/2 cup strawberry puree
- 1 tbsp gelatin (dissolved in 2 tbsp warm water)
For the Jelly Topping:
- 1 1/2 cups fresh strawberries (sliced)
- 1 cup strawberry juice
- 1 tbsp gelatin (dissolved in 2 tbsp warm water)
Instructions
- Bake the Base: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Beat eggs and sugar until fluffy, then mix in vanilla, flour, baking powder, and milk. Pour into a greased cake pan and bake for 15 minutes. Let cool.
- Prepare the Mousse: Whip heavy cream until soft peaks form. In another bowl, mix cream cheese, powdered sugar, and strawberry puree. Gently fold in whipped cream and dissolved gelatin. Spread over the cooled cake base and refrigerate for 1 hour.
- Make the Jelly Topping: Arrange sliced strawberries on top of the mousse layer. Mix strawberry juice with dissolved gelatin and gently pour over the strawberries.
- Chill & Serve: Refrigerate for at least 4 hours until fully set. Slice and enjoy!
Notes
- Use fresh or frozen strawberries for the puree.
- Ensure the mousse layer is firm before pouring the jelly topping to prevent mixing.
- Swap strawberry juice for raspberry or mixed berry juice for a flavor twist.
